Lindsey returns to the Bruins after leading the team with 19-8 record and 193 strikeouts.  Lindsey a 2nd team All-Region selection, she also helped at the plate with 45 RBI’s and a .320 batting average.  Lindsey wants to improve on being a better leader and teammate in her sophomore year.  Her best memory of her freshmen season was sweeping NIC to win the SWAC title.

Kara returns for her sophomore year looking to improve on a great freshmen season.  During her first year Kara batted .302 and was 14-7 with a 3.63 era for the Bruins.  Kara also received 2nd team All-Region honors.  Kara’s best memory from last year was beating NIC four times in a row.  Academically Kara was on the dean’s list but looks to improve that by becoming an Academic All American.
